Defining the Partner Operating Model
Selecting the right operating model is critical to the success of a white-label ERP program. The three primary models are customer-led, partner-led, and co-delivery. Each has distinct advantages and limitations that must be evaluated against the partner's capabilities and the client's maturity.
- Customer-Led Implementation: The client manages the project, with the partner providing advisory and technical support. This model is suitable for clients with strong internal IT teams but may lead to slower adoption and higher risk of scope creep.
- Partner-Led Implementation: The partner owns the delivery process, managing timelines, resources, and client communication. This model offers greater control over quality and speed but requires significant partner investment in delivery expertise.
- Co-Delivery Model: Responsibilities are shared between the partner and the client, with clear delineation of tasks. This is often the most balanced approach, leveraging the partner's technical expertise and the client's domain knowledge.
In a white-label context, the partner typically assumes the role of the primary service provider, even if the underlying ERP is provided by a third-party vendor. This means the partner must manage the vendor relationship, ensure service level agreements (SLAs) are met, and handle client escalations. The operating model must clearly define who owns decision rights at each stage of the implementation lifecycle, from discovery to post-go-live stabilization.
Governance Framework and Role Responsibilities
Effective governance is the backbone of a successful white-label ERP program. It ensures that all parties understand their roles, responsibilities, and accountability. A robust governance framework should include a steering committee, project management office (PMO), and technical working groups.
| Role | Responsibility | Accountability |
|---|---|---|
| ERP Vendor | Provide core platform, updates, and technical support | Platform stability, security patches, core functionality |
| Implementation Partner | Manage client relationship, delivery, and customization | Project success, client satisfaction, SLA compliance |
| Client | Provide requirements, data, and user adoption | Business process definition, data accuracy, user training |
The governance structure must also define escalation paths for issues that cannot be resolved at the working level. This includes technical escalations to the ERP vendor, commercial escalations to the partner's leadership, and strategic escalations to the client's executive team. Clear escalation paths prevent issues from stagnating and ensure timely resolution.

Integration Architecture and Data Flow
Logistics ERP systems rarely operate in isolation. They must integrate with other enterprise systems such as CRM, finance, warehouse management, and transportation management systems. The integration architecture should be designed to be scalable, secure, and maintainable.
API-first design is a best practice for white-label ERP integrations. Using REST APIs or GraphQL allows for flexible and efficient data exchange between systems. Middleware or iPaaS platforms can be used to orchestrate complex data flows and handle error management. Event-driven architecture can be employed for real-time data synchronization, ensuring that logistics operations are always up-to-date.
Data integration must also consider data quality and consistency. The partner should implement data validation rules and error handling mechanisms to ensure that data flowing between systems is accurate and complete. This is particularly important in logistics, where data errors can lead to significant operational disruptions.

Risk Management and Mitigation
White-label ERP programs carry inherent risks, including technical risks, delivery risks, and commercial risks. The partner must implement a robust risk management process to identify, assess, and mitigate these risks.
Technical risks include platform instability, integration failures, and security breaches. The partner should mitigate these risks by conducting thorough testing, implementing robust security measures, and maintaining a disaster recovery plan. Delivery risks include scope creep, resource constraints, and client misalignment. The partner should mitigate these risks by implementing strict change management, ensuring adequate resourcing, and maintaining regular communication with the client.
Commercial risks include vendor dependency, pricing disputes, and revenue shortfalls. The partner should mitigate these risks by negotiating favorable terms with the ERP vendor, implementing transparent pricing, and diversifying its revenue streams.
